Tag: Bigfoot

Bigfoot Elected Mayor in Shocking Upset, Promises to Protect Mythical Creatures’ Rights

In an astounding and almost unbelievable turn of events, the residents of the remote town of Pinecrest, Canada, have elected Bigfoot, the legendary cryptid, as their new mayor. The extraordinary outcome has left political analysts and the wider world completely baffled, while the town’s inhabitants celebrate the victory of their unlikely new leader. The gigantic, […]

Back To Top